Men's soccer falls at Capital

Waynesburg scores first, but falls 3-1 to Crusaders

COLUMBUS, Ohio (Sept. 17) – The Waynesburg University men's soccer team hit the road for a matchup with Capital University on Saturday. The Yellow Jackets looked poised to pull an upset following the game's first score, but the Crusaders rebounded to take the 3-1 victory
 
Waynesburg (2-4) managed to slip in the game's first tally just before halftime. Junior Zach Mitschke scored his team-leading second goal of 2016 during the 43rd minute of action to put the Jackets ahead 1-0. The visiting squad carried that edge into halftime, before Capital (5-1) tied the contest at 1-1 10:47 into the second period.
 
The home team notched the eventual game winner three minutes later to go up 2-1. Capital added an insurance goal in the 83rd minute to seal up the victory.
 
Sophomore goalkeeper James Snyder started and played all 90 minutes in net. He stopped nine-of-12 shots on goal.
 
Waynesburg returns to play on Monday, Sept. 19, with a home game against Franciscan. Start time is scheduled for 8 p.m.
